Following code is to find specific user("eveadams"). But it does not work.

# Find User
kwargs = {"name": "eveadams"}

try:
    users = service.users.list(**kwargs)
    for user in users:
        print "%s - %s" % (user.realname, user.name)

except: # new user
    print "Cannot find the user"

eveadams is already exist in splunk. But the result is always "Cannot find...".
